在当今数字化时代,网络基础知识已成为每个人都应该掌握的重要技能。无论是日常使用互联网,还是在职场中需要处理网络相关的工作,了解网络的基本概念和计算方式都至关重要。本文将带你深入探讨网络基础知识,特别是在计算方面的内容,帮助你更好地理解网络工作原理。
一、网络基础知识概述
网络基础知识涵盖了计算机网络的基本概念、组成部分以及网络如何通过各种协议进行通信。下面是一些关键概念:
- 网络:由多台计算机和其他设备通过网络接口相互连接的集合。
- 协议:网络通信的规则和标准,如TCP/IP协议。
- 路由器:连接不同网络并转发数据包的设备。
- 交换机:在同一网络中转发数据包的设备。
- IP地址:用于标识网络中每个设备的唯一地址。
二、网络计算的基本概念
网络计算是指在网络环境中进行的数据处理和计算。它的基本原理包括:数据传输、带宽计算、延迟计算等。下面,我们将详细解释这些概念。
三、数据传输的基本原理
数据在网络中传输时,通常会被分为多个数据包进行发送。这些数据包携带着源地址和目标地址,以便正确传输至目的地。数据传输的几个重要因素包括:
- 带宽:网络中可用的传输容量,通常以每秒比特(bit/s)表示。
- 延迟:从数据包发送到接收所需的时间,通常以毫秒(ms)计量。
- 丢包率:在数据传输过程中丢失的数据包比例。
四、带宽计算
带宽是影响网络性能的一个重要因素。计算带宽的常用公式为:
带宽 (bps) = 数据量 (bit) / 传输时间 (秒)
例如,如果传输一个500MB大小的文件,耗时40秒,则带宽为:
带宽 = (500 * 1024 * 1024 * 8) bit / 40 s ≈ 10737418.24 bps ≈ 10.74 Mbps
五、延迟计算
延迟是指在网络中数据从源到达目的地所需的时间,影响用户体验。延迟的计算通常涉及三个主要部分:
- 传输延迟:数据包在介质中传输的时间。
- 处理延迟:路由器或者交换机处理数据包所需的时间。
- 排队延迟:数据包在发送前在路由器或交换机中的等待时间。
可以将延迟计算为这三者的总和:
总延迟 = 传输延迟 + 处理延迟 + 排队延迟
六、丢包率计算
丢包率是衡量网络性能的另一个指标,计算公式为:
丢包率 = 丢失的数据包数量 / 发送的数据包数量 * 100%
例如,如果发送了1000个数据包,但有50个数据包丢失,丢包率为:
丢包率 = 50 / 1000 * 100% = 5%
七、总结与应用
掌握网络基础知识和计算概念不仅有助于解决遇到的技术问题,也为进一步的学习打下了基础。在职场中,尤其是在IT行业,理解如何计算带宽、延迟和丢包率等指标,能够帮助你优化网络资源,提高工作效率。
在个人生活中,这些知识也能够让你更有效地管理你的网络设备,解决网络连接问题,从而提升互联网使用体验。
感谢您花时间阅读这篇文章!希望通过这篇文章,您能够对网络基础知识有更深入的了解,并掌握相关的计算方法,提升您的网络使用能力。